Output aa58f3029121b6f171d8b6c4490b4fa83f3d1c79e586f5b014ccdc7baca4ebd7:1

value
101379900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f6527b731ccf3b0feda8a4fd6200ff85e8229d OP_EQUAL
address
3JjagzQ7RUb5ykLPxSwgHEnMsvoFspb97M
transaction
aa58f3029121b6f171d8b6c4490b4fa83f3d1c79e586f5b014ccdc7baca4ebd7
spent
true